Greenhouse Controller — Sensor Drift Runbook (excerpt)

Heads up: the Vernalite humidity sensors drift upward roughly 2% per week, so the controller recalibrates nightly against the reference probe. If a release touches the calibration job, hold the rollout until drift offsets are re-baselined. You can eyeball the current offsets in the calibration table via the connection string below.

primary connection of yagep-kahip = redis://giliel_svc:zYiKsLL2PLpfPL@db-348f.xolmarsys.corp:5432/fenwyn

Attendees: J. Marlow (chair), F. Okafor, D. Breen, S. Halliwell. Main item: the revised sales-commission scheme. Everyone agreed the old flat-rate setup was past its sell-by date. New plan: stepped rates, a team bonus pool, and no more year-end true-ups — reps hated those. Okafor flagged the Glenmere team's concerns about mid-year contract switches; Breen will sort transition rules. Rollout aimed at the new fiscal year, comms to follow. For the board's eyes, the confidential planning note sits just below.

confidential, kajof-kajof: Fenirox Works plans to raise the Zorys list price by 31 percent in October.

## Formula sandbox tuning

User-supplied formulas in Gridmoor execute inside a restricted interpreter with hard ceilings on time, memory, and call depth. Reviewers should confirm any change to these ceilings is justified in the PR description, since raising them widens the abuse surface. Defaults were chosen from production traces. The current limits are as follows.

limits module of tafog-fawip:
WEIGHTS = {
    "julix": 57,
    "lamys": 992,
    "kasvan": 209,
    "quenok": 750,
    "alddor": 259,
    "oliath": 1009,
    "wenix": 815,
}